Output 616efbd56ab16982808f23eaee01d40ad51a054f1694f40e23bd986220687630:1

value
24314550
script pubkey
OP_0 OP_PUSHBYTES_20 f16d2e19689ea0df4a37d06c6b7e53451b1ea461
address
bc1q79kjuxtgn6sd7j3h6pkxkljng5d3afrp6apqne
transaction
616efbd56ab16982808f23eaee01d40ad51a054f1694f40e23bd986220687630
spent
true